Anhydrous Nylon 6-10, xH(3)PO(4) films have been studied by infrared and impedance spectroscopies. The CONH/acid interactions evolve from strong hydrogen bonding to protonation depending on acid concentration and temperature. Protonic conductivity reaches a value as high as 10(-3) S/cm at 25 degrees C for Nylon 6-10, 2.5 H3PO4.
